This page expands the state overview with per-code operational data from NANPA: parent codes, projected exhaust dates, dialing patterns and relief status for all 6 South Carolina codes.

Aggregate footprint: the state's 6 geographic codes currently carry 2,721 active NXX prefixes over 370 rate-center anchorings, with 1,951 prefixes in thousands-block pooling. 6 of the codes serve territory inside FCC top-100 metropolitan statistical areas.

Lineage: 821 came out of 864 in 2024; 839 came out of 803 in 2020; 843 came out of 803 in 1998; 854 came out of 843 in 2015; 864 came out of 803 in 1995. The remaining code (803) dates back to the plan's early assignments.

Dialing plans: 6 codes use plain ten-digit local dialing (10D). Overlay territories always dial ten digits; the 2021 988-hotline transition moved most others to ten digits as well.

The tightest capacity in the state is 803 (complex 803/839), projected to exhaust 1Q 2046.

Status: no South Carolina code is currently in jeopardy or active relief planning — capacity is adequate near-term per NANPA.

Code-by-code notes

864 — spawned 821; carved from 803; overlaid by 821; exhaust forecast 3Q 2054.

803 — spawned 864, 843, 839; overlaid by 839; exhaust forecast 1Q 2046.

843 — spawned 854; carved from 803; overlaid by 854; exhaust forecast 1Q 2053.

854 — carved from 843; overlaid by 843; exhaust forecast 1Q 2053.

839 — carved from 803; overlaid by 803; exhaust forecast 1Q 2046.

821 — carved from 864; overlaid by 864; exhaust forecast 3Q 2054.
